O que é Crawler?

Um crawler, também conhecido como spider ou bot, é um programa automatizado que navega pela internet de forma sistemática. Esses softwares são utilizados principalmente por motores de busca, como Google, Bing e Yahoo, para indexar o conteúdo das páginas da web. O objetivo principal de um crawler é coletar informações sobre as páginas da web, permitindo que os motores de busca ofereçam resultados relevantes e atualizados aos usuários que realizam pesquisas. A eficiência e a eficácia de um crawler são fundamentais para a qualidade dos resultados apresentados nas páginas de busca.

Como Funciona um Crawler?

Os crawlers começam sua jornada na web a partir de uma lista de URLs conhecidas, que podem ser obtidas de várias fontes, como sitemaps ou links de outras páginas. Ao acessar uma página, o crawler analisa seu conteúdo, extrai informações relevantes e segue os links presentes na página para descobrir novos conteúdos. Esse processo de “crawling” é contínuo, pois os crawlers precisam atualizar constantemente suas bases de dados para refletir as mudanças na web, como novas páginas, alterações de conteúdo e remoções de URLs.

Importância dos Crawlers para SEO

Para profissionais de SEO, entender como os crawlers funcionam é crucial. A maneira como um site é estruturado e como seu conteúdo é apresentado pode influenciar diretamente a capacidade do crawler de indexar as páginas de forma eficaz. Um site bem otimizado facilita o trabalho dos crawlers, aumentando as chances de que suas páginas sejam indexadas rapidamente e apareçam nas primeiras posições dos resultados de busca. Além disso, a utilização de práticas como a criação de sitemaps e a implementação de arquivos robots.txt pode ajudar a direcionar o comportamento dos crawlers.

Tipos de Crawlers

Existem diferentes tipos de crawlers, cada um com suas características e finalidades. Os crawlers de motores de busca são os mais conhecidos, mas também existem crawlers especializados que podem ser utilizados para fins específicos, como monitoramento de preços, coleta de dados para análise de concorrência e até mesmo para a indexação de conteúdo em redes sociais. Cada tipo de crawler opera de maneira distinta, dependendo de seus objetivos e da forma como foram programados.

Desafios Enfrentados pelos Crawlers

Os crawlers enfrentam diversos desafios durante sua operação. Um dos principais obstáculos é a presença de conteúdo dinâmico, que pode dificultar a indexação correta das informações. Além disso, muitos sites utilizam técnicas de bloqueio, como o uso de arquivos robots.txt, que podem restringir o acesso dos crawlers a determinadas áreas do site. Outro desafio é a quantidade massiva de dados disponíveis na web, o que torna a tarefa de indexação uma atividade complexa e que demanda recursos significativos.

Como os Crawlers Influenciam o Ranking de Sites

O comportamento dos crawlers tem um impacto direto no ranking dos sites nos motores de busca. Quando um crawler visita uma página, ele analisa diversos fatores, como a relevância do conteúdo, a qualidade dos links internos e externos, e a estrutura do site. Esses fatores são considerados pelos algoritmos dos motores de busca para determinar a posição de um site nos resultados de pesquisa. Portanto, uma boa otimização para crawlers pode resultar em um melhor posicionamento nas páginas de resultados.

Ferramentas para Monitorar Crawlers

Existem várias ferramentas disponíveis que permitem aos profissionais de SEO monitorar a atividade dos crawlers em seus sites. Ferramentas como Google Search Console, SEMrush e Ahrefs oferecem insights valiosos sobre como os crawlers estão interagindo com as páginas, quais URLs estão sendo indexadas e se há problemas que precisam ser resolvidos. Essas informações são essenciais para ajustar estratégias de SEO e garantir que o site esteja sempre otimizado para os motores de busca.

Impacto da Velocidade de Carregamento nas Atividades dos Crawlers

A velocidade de carregamento de uma página é um fator crítico que pode afetar a eficiência dos crawlers. Páginas que demoram muito para carregar podem ser abandonadas pelos crawlers antes que todo o conteúdo seja indexado, resultando em uma indexação incompleta. Além disso, a velocidade de carregamento é um dos fatores considerados pelos motores de busca para determinar o ranking das páginas. Portanto, otimizar a velocidade de um site não apenas melhora a experiência do usuário, mas também facilita o trabalho dos crawlers.

O Futuro dos Crawlers

Com o avanço da tecnologia e o aumento da complexidade da web, o futuro dos crawlers está em constante evolução. Novas técnicas de inteligência artificial e aprendizado de máquina estão sendo incorporadas aos algoritmos dos motores de busca, permitindo que os crawlers se tornem mais inteligentes e eficientes na indexação de conteúdo. Além disso, a crescente popularidade de aplicativos móveis e conteúdo dinâmico exige que os crawlers se adaptem para garantir que todas as informações relevantes sejam capturadas e apresentadas aos usuários de forma eficaz.